Boat removal in Yorba Linda is rarely simple: fiberglass hulls are non-recyclable in most waste streams, gas and oil have to be drained before disposal, and lien-sale documentation has to travel with the vessel. ClearEdge coordinates all of it — from Orange County disposal facility scheduling to trailer permits when the hull is oversize.

We are a commercial removal contractor, not a resale broker. If the vessel is salvageable, we route it to a marine salvage partner and credit any scrap value against the invoice. If it is a total loss, it goes to a permitted non-hazardous demolition and disposal facility with documentation returned.

How much does boat removal cost in Yorba Linda, CA?

For boat removal in Yorba Linda, CA: Boat removal is priced per vessel based on length, hull material, whether it is on a trailer, and whether fluids need to be drained before disposal. Most single-vessel removals fall between $600 and $2,500 all-in with disposal documentation returned.

Do you drain fuel and oil in Yorba Linda, CA?

For boat removal in Yorba Linda, CA: Fuel, oil, coolant, and holding-tank draining is coordinated with a licensed hazardous-waste partner before we haul the hull. That work is not included in the base non-hazardous scope but we quote it alongside removal.

What happens to the boat after pickup in Yorba Linda, CA?

For boat removal in Yorba Linda, CA: Salvageable vessels are routed to a marine salvage yard and any scrap value is credited against the invoice. Total-loss hulls go to a permitted non-hazardous demolition and disposal facility with a disposal documentation returned.
